Output c27555e54bdf6355e169f3e907634c35636de2e97338cab3293ad2719cf8a36a:0

value
517529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b40ef1cbdc4aafbc8cb7d330b2aacca31a670d5 OP_EQUAL
address
3LDitBT6nnXYFvxXW43XGia1eC42Hc8vqN
transaction
c27555e54bdf6355e169f3e907634c35636de2e97338cab3293ad2719cf8a36a
spent
true